Rae Maile: A Lifetime in Tobacco

Sep 27, 2024
Rae Maile, a seasoned tobacco industry analyst with over 35 years of experience, shares his insights on the evolving nicotine landscape. He discusses the tobacco industry's resilience, the dynamics of taxation and illicit trade, and the changing sentiments of anti-smoking groups. Rae also dives into the regulatory challenges facing next-gen nicotine products and critiques the obsession with volume over critical variables. His unique writing style and the importance of storytelling in analysis are highlighted, bringing a fresh perspective to the tobacco sector.

Perpetual Pessimism Masks Durability

  • The industry repeatedly faces perpetual pessimism from analysts and executives despite long-term resilience.
  • Rae Maile points out that skepticism about tobacco's future has persisted since the 1950s yet profits endured.
INSIGHT

Population Growth Offsets Prevalence Declines

  • Declining smoking prevalence can hide stable or rising smoker counts because populations grow.
  • WHO still estimates about a billion smokers globally, so demand remains large.
INSIGHT

New Products Change Markets Unevenly

  • Next-gen products reshape markets unevenly by country and history rather than replacing combustibles uniformly.
  • Many consumers still prefer cigarettes for ritual, satisfaction, and social theatre.
